New Rail Trail in Rockland & Abington on Track

Nearly 10,000 feet of new trail has been opened along the former Hanover Branch Railroad Corridor.

The new rail-to-trail project along the former Hanover Branch Railroad Corridor in Rockland and Abington is humming right along. Almost 10,000 linear feet of recreational trail is now open for walking, biking, and cross-country skiing, funded by a $100,000 state grant. Next up: additional paving and the addition of trail signs and maps.
